Hi all, thought it was about time to start my build. Have been meaning to since I picked up the car in early March but that work thing has been busy.
This is the 8th 4wd I have owned. The Prado replaced a Nissan Navara D40 that was 4 years old, 140,000kms on the clock. It needed it's third clutch, gearbox to be repaired/reconditioned, new fuel pump, it leaked, was as uncomfotable as hell, so it was time for atrade in. I'd bee looking at the Prado for a while and ordered it in December 2011, exactly 3 months from order to delivery.
To say I have noticed the difference is an understatement, much more comfortable, much better build quality and much better on and off road.
Mods done:
OME suspension
Mickey Thompson ATZ 4 rib 265/70 R 17(good but noisy)
Safari snorkel
Redarc BCDC40 dual battery
Genuine Toyota towbar
Time for new UHF, Icom 440n with GME antenna
Sheepskin seatcovers on the front and wetsuit type on the rear
ARB Sahara bar in white
Tigers11 winch (from previous car)
Tigers11 awning
Rhino SXB roof bars
To come soon:
amts bash plates
amts spare wheel holder
Install my ARB compressor from the previous car under bonnet ASAP
Front window tint
Rear drawer, fridge slide setup. Still debating which one, like the look of the Drifta setup, but my ARB fridge slide won't fit apparently, so still thinking about it.
Diff lock, still deciding on front or rear
Full length roof rack of some sort
HID ugrade to the high beam
Probably spotties of some sort, HID, brand to be decided
